@brandenflasch Yeah. The 423+ has an Intel CPU and the 923+ has an AMD. The AMD is great for most things, but if you ever wanted to run OLED on it, Plex won’t do hardware transcoding on AMD processors. The Intel in the 423+ can easily transcode 4k to 1080p for watching outside the house.
